Newton's Telecom Dictionary: Covering Telecommunications, Networking, Information Technology, Computing and the Internet

Rate this book
Covering more than 21,000 definitions, the most comprehensive guide to telecommunications terms available covers wireless, broadband, intranet, e-commerce, IT, and technology finance terms, including thousands of new terms added since the last edition. Original. 50,000 first printing.

After working in the computer industry for years I
thought I was accustomed to jargon and acronyms, then
we started making computers for telecom companies and
working with them. Phone companies have an 80yr
head start on creating their own gobbldygook and this
book was a great help in deciphering it all, ok most
of it.
